Well there seems to be some more information slowly being squeezed out.

According to some transcripts from a conversation by a Central Intelligence Agency's former Deputy Chief of Clandestine Operations Robert Richer, the directive may point to Dick Cheney's pet operational group, the Office of Special Plans. You folks remember the OSP, that group of people under Dick Cheney and Scooter Libby that was headed up by one of America's top neoconservative attack dogs, Douglas Feith.

Boy, imagine for a moment that the Vice President of the United States ordered a forged document to take this country to war... my oh my, lets all be thankful that Nancy the spineless Pelosi said impeachment was off the table huh.

If true, I wonder what these people will for an encore, invade Russia?



Tape: Top CIA official confesses order to forge Iraq-9/11 letter came on White House stationery


The Raw Story | Tape: Top CIA official confesses order to forge Iraq-9/11 letter came on White House stationery

Quote:
A forged letter linking Saddam Hussein to the Sept. 11, 2001 attacks was ordered on White House stationery and probably came from the office of Vice President Dick Cheney, according to a new transcript of a conversation with the Central Intelligence Agency's former Deputy Chief of Clandestine Operations Robert Richer.
